Cost

If you suffer from ADHD An official diagnosis can assist you in getting the support you need. You can get treatment privately or via NHS referral. However, the NHS is not without its waiting times, which is why many patients opt to pay for private assessment. This can save you money and time however, it is essential to ensure that the person performing your evaluation has the right qualifications. Doctors are not trained to assess ADHD Therefore, it is imperative to go to an expert psychiatrist or psychologist.

A private ADHD assessment usually costs between PS500 and PS800 which includes consultation time as well as a report and trial of medication. During the session you will meet with a neurobehavioural psychiatric specialist who is specialized in ADHD. They will discuss with you your symptoms as well as your mental history and family history. They will also make recommendations for non-medicative treatments. The assessment can last up to one hour and you will be able to select the best medication for your needs.

Depending on the service provider, your private ADHD assessment could include a face to face consultation, or telephone or online video follow-up. It's worth checking with the service provider to determine their policy regarding this. Some require an GP referral letter, whereas others don't. If your GP isn't able to refer you it is possible to locate an alternative GP especially in the event that you are interested in a medication shared care agreement.

Many people are willing pay for an individual ADHD diagnosis because the NHS can take up to five years to conduct an assessment. There are many who are waiting for tests and it's difficult to deal with them while they wait. A diagnosis that is formal can help patients receive treatment and help and improve their quality of living.

Panorama The Panorama BBC investigation, has revealed mistakes in a variety of private ADHD clinics. However, it is important to remember that most private clinics adhere to the highest standards. Untreated ADHD can cause serious problems in the areas of work, education and relationships. It is also associated with a reduction of 12.7 years in life expectancy. This is comparable to Type 2 diabetes.

In England, GPs have a legal right to recommend adults to an ADHD assessment to any provider they prefer, as long as the provider is licensed to perform NHS assessments in their region. This is known as Right to Choose and it will often cut down on waiting time for assessments. However, the GP must still be able to accept the referral.

The NHS is in crisis. Since 2009, investment in adult ADHD services has been cut by more than PS70 million. The rotas for psychiatrists to assess adults are full and there is a massive inconsistency between demand and capacity. This has led to the emergence of quick fixes, ranging from online assessments to fake clinics like those included in Panorama.
